Transaction 720be81e20ccf92a826a7156cd35ceb7aa00eaa51279b8459c0b7f04aec79d31
4 Input
2 Outputs
- 720be81e20ccf92a826a7156cd35ceb7aa00eaa51279b8459c0b7f04aec79d31:0
- 720be81e20ccf92a826a7156cd35ceb7aa00eaa51279b8459c0b7f04aec79d31:1
value 852618
address 1CfJhLPrPAd3BbdoU3gCDtWufXgVc3BgmH
value 4219818
address 1PhY49rvuSynuJTLsEN6TUnfdPUopZxkhL